Rain forces State Cup delay

This past weekend, many boys U17 soccer teams, including sophomores Chase Hester and Collin Robidoux’s Indialantic team, had a cancellation of state cup games in Fort Myers on Sunday due to a rain flooding the fields the night before.

The team played Saturday at 10 a.m., losing 2-1 to Pinecrest, a team from Miami.

“I was really disappointed in the loss,” Hester said. “We were all over them during the second half, but we couldn’t find a way to put the ball in the net. Now we just have to move on to the next game and being that it was canceled on Sunday, the team has the opportunity to figure out what we need to do to win so we can move on to the Sweet 16 round of State Cup. ”

Robidoux also had some thoughts regarding the cancellation of the Sunday game.

“I’m mad about the game being cancelled because that means we have to drive to Fort Myers again next weekend to play the makeup game,” he said. “But right now every team in our group has three points so this next game determines if we stay in state cup or not. Right now, the team needs to worry more about this next game rather than the long drive that comes with it.

The makeup game will be in Fort Myers on Saturday at 10 a.m.
